HAYDEN W. HEAD TERMINAL

The following are some interesting statistics regarding the Hayden W. Head Terminal at Corpus Christi International Airport:

Hayden W. Head Terminal

Overhead View of Inside Terminal

Architectural Firm: M. Arthur Gensler, Jr. and Associates
Contractor: Fulton/Coastcon
Ground Breaking Date: March 31, 2000
Terminal Opening: November 3, 2002
Square Feet: 165,000
Cubic Yards of Concrete: 18,400
Square Feet of Glass: 17,000
Square Yards of Carpet: 2,500
Terrazzo Flooring: 42,000 square feet
Number of Gates: 6


Artwork at the Airport

When the Sun Meets the Sea: Enjoy this large scale cold casting glass sculpture that hangs in the Hayden W. Head Terminal. Chinese born artist Shan Shan Sheng designed the 42-piece exhibit. The hanging panels making up the sculpture are comprised of cold cast glass in a variety of different shapes and colors. The artwork is suspended from the ceiling with stainless steel aircraft cable.

Bag Claim Belt
Baggage Claim: Corpus Christi International Airport is equipped with two baggage carousels. They are conveniently located on the first floor of the new terminal directly across from the car rental counters. The state of the art carousels provide passengers with convenient and efficient means with which to collect their luggage.
